Block Plant Supervisor

Naunton Quarry, Gloucestershire

Breedon are currently seeking an Block Plant Supervisor to join our small, friendly team at our Naunton Block Plant based in Naunton Quarry, Gloucestershire.

Where you'll be working:

Reporting to the Block Plant Manager this role is part of our block manufacturing business at our site in the heart of the Cotswolds.

What you'll be doing:

  • Uphold and enforce all Breedon Safety, policies, procedures and environmental commitments
  • To oversee and manage the Naunton Block Plant production process so production targets can be achieved within budgeted costs
  • Organise the team to optimise individual skills, ensuring H&S, production and quality standards are achieved
  • Manage and maintain site equipment and tools to ensure efficient and effective use at all times
  • Ensure raw materials orders are placed to meet production requirements
  • Manage stocks of raw materials and finished goods
